How Much Does an Associate in Business Administration from Vance-Granville Community College Cost?

$1,948 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Vance-Granville Community College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Vance-Granville Community College paid an average of $268 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$76 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$1,824$6,432
Fees$124$124
Books and Supplies$1,550$1,550

How Much Can You Make With an ABA in Business Administration From Vance-Granville Community College?

$27,048 Average Salary
Below Average Earnings Boost

business administration who receive their associate degree from Vance-Granville Community College make an average of $27,048 a year during the early days of their career. That is 5% lower than the national average of $28,330.

Vance-Granville Community College Associate Student Diversity for Business Administration

19 Associate Degrees Awarded
63.2% Women
47.4%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 19 associate degrees in business administration hand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 63.2% of the business administration students who took home an associate degree in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 54.9%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 47.4% of the business administration associate degrees at Vance-Granville Community College in 2019-2020. This is lower than the nationwide number of 49%.
